    Passive buzzer is characterized by:

    1 passive without shock source, so if the DC signal can not make it tweet. It must be driven by a square wave of 2K~5K

    2 voice frequency controllable, can make "to send Tracy cable" effect.

    3 in some special cases, you can reuse a control port with LED

    Active buzzer is characterized by:

    1 active buzzer with shock source, so as long as a power will be called

    2 easy to program control, a high and low level of the microcontroller can make it sound, but not a passive buzzer.
